Major game publisher Activision is currently being sued by a Call of Duty esports team for perpetuating an alleged monopoly over its competitive scene. The Call of Duty games are a hit among pro FPS players, which is why they are crying out over the way the company has been handling tournaments and organized play.
EA Sports College Football 25 has revealed its logo and has announced that fans can expect a full reveal of the game in May. It also released a new (non-gameplay) trailer that seems to have confirmed an assortment of programs and locations that will be featured in the anticipated title. This is exciting news for fans, especially after a previous EA Sports College Football 25 rumor turned out to be false.

Remember the story from last week about the image of a revolver and map of Texas, etched into one of the layers in AMD's old K7 chips? Not surprisingly, it isn't an isolated example of silicon shenanigans, as uncovered by a fan of chip easter eggs shows in an awesome compilation of processors, controllers, and memory die shots. Ducks, zombies, sharks, and dragons rub shoulders with the Playboy logo and a guitar-playing T-rex.
